One of the best ways to improve the security of a uPVC window is to put in a sash jammer. Jamming devices can stop burglars from opening the window.

Many uPVC windows have multi-locking systems to provide greater security. Multi-locking mechanisms will ensure that the window is secure in various places around the sash.

Anti-snap locks can improve security. Anti-snap locks are specially designed to stop the barrel of the lock from snapping.

To change a handle, you must remove the two screws that are located at the base. This will let you install an entirely new handle. There are several types of handles available. You can pick a style that is in line with your window style and locks with espag.

It is easy to change window handles. Make sure you match the direction of the espag lock. Also, consider the distance from the back of the window. It's a good idea to achieve the step height of 21mm for aluminum windows, and 9mm for uPVC windows.

Cockspur handles are found on older frames. They are typically installed with three or four screws. Professional window installers can measure for you.
